Frequently Asked Questions about Seaton

What type of rentals are currently available in Seaton?

There are currently 43 Apartments for Rent in Seaton, IL with pricing that ranges from $452 to $2,140. There are also 32 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Seaton ranging from $600 to $3,100.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Seaton?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Seaton ranges from $600 to $3,100 with an average monthly rent of $1,388.
